Easter Bug
Hello, here are the first pics from the easter-bug.... It is powered by
a 13T brushless set and the 'Hump-pack' is my modified 3000mAh Lipo. I
deceided not to use my Buggy Champ so i throwed in all my SRB-spares and
added re-release parts to get it complete. Will try to add a video soon,
lot of fun to drive also with the old radio-gear ;)

I like the color choice as well, great look..What brushless motor are you using?..looking to get one to fit mine as well.
metallifits
Hello and Thanks for the comments, the
motor is an LRP Eraser Brushless 13,5T
motor. It fits very well using some small
spacers and light cutting the re-release
motorcover. The 60A Ezrun ESC is placed
behind the Hump-pack with no problems
